**Whisperstone Audio Guide — playback stalls**

Support folks: if a visitor reports the guide freezing mid-exhibit, it's usually the gallery wifi handoff between the Atrium and the Fossil Hall. Have them toggle offline mode — all tours are pre-downloaded. If stalls persist on offline mode, collect the device log from Settings > Diagnostics and file it with the token shown below.

build token for fahap-yagag: htk3_d09

I am writing to confirm that Project Larkspur, our internal workflow consolidation effort, will slip approximately six weeks beyond the original milestone. The delay stems from integration issues between the Quenholm scheduling module and legacy reporting tools, compounded by resourcing gaps after two analysts moved to the Tarvens rollout. Mitigation steps are underway, and department heads will receive revised timelines Friday. Budget impact remains contained. The strategic implications are summarised in the confidential note below.

board note of bawep-tajef: Queniusek Systems plans to raise the Quenvan list price by 53.1 percent in March. The pricing group signed off on a budget of $176.4 million for Project Drueth. The renewal with Casionix Partners closes at $142.5 million a year, 8.3 percent below the last contract. Project Fraax slips by six weeks because of the tooling delay.

## Onboarding — Restockr deploy basics

Restockr plans vending-machine restock routes for the Fennimore campus fleet. Deploys go through the `restockr-deploy` pipeline: build, run the route-solver smoke test, push to staging, then promote. Access to the production host uses a shared deploy identity managed by the platform squad; rotate it quarterly. Never deploy from a laptop. Keep the solver config in sync with staging before promoting. The deploy key currently in use is shown below.

deploy key for kajof-fajop: bky6_gDHw9Q

**FAQ: Why does Spanview choke on diffs over 50 MB?**

Good question — Spanview streams large files in chunks, but diffs past 50 MB trigger the safety cap so your browser doesn't melt. As a reviewer you can raise the cap per-session under Settings → Limits, or use the CLI viewer, which has no cap at all. One gotcha: the CLI keeps its config in an encrypted store, and first-time setup asks you to unlock it. Use the recovery passphrase given below.

unlock words, yawig-kagef: gordor-holvan-ulaael-pramir-ulaiel-tamdor